25-35CPM Automatic 18L Conical Steel Pail Making Line 

Workflow: Input---Seam Welding---Lacquering---Seam Drying---Standinig---Expanding---Flanging+Pre-curling---Top Curling---Body Beading---Upending---Bottom Seaming---Upending---Spot Welding---Air Testing---Output

layout for 18l steel pail can line

Machine Features:

1.  We adopt PLC, Servo motor, frequency conversion motor to realize full-automatic control;

2. With Mechanical cam transmission, cam clamping & holding cans, cam conveying cans, speed is continuously adjustable, machines run stably and reliably;

3. There are detecting and protecting devices for right position movements, can stuck and every function. It ensures whole production line smooth and safe;

4.  Height can be adjusted automatically by PLC, automatic terminal detection, it makes mould changing easy and fast.
